A coastal town in the south of Portugal, Lagos is known for its old world charm, plummeting cliffs, and Atlantic beaches. Many come to enjoy a full range of activities from beach-going and watersports to exploring cobbled streets lined with options for shopping and dining. Historic churches and castles add to the charm, as well as a clifftop lighthouse showing the way to Lagos for ships at sea.
Ezcaray, Spain is a great place to go if you are looking for a scenic, relaxing, and peaceful destination. It is located in the Sierra de la Demanda mountains on the banks of the Oja river. Because of the mountain range nearby, it is also a great place for mountaineers. Ezcaray is a small town with big charm and momentous possibilities. It is located right at the base of the San Lorenzo peak in the Oja valley in the La Rioja region of Spain. The town has a population of less than 2,000, so it is a far cry from big city life, but that's part of what makes it such a gem to visit. Some say it is one of the best locations to get an authentic feel of real Spain without the big touristy populations. Its sheer beauty has also been compared to something out of a fairy tale.

These are the overall average travel costs for the two destinations.
The average daily cost (per person) in Lagos is €118, while the average daily cost in Ezcaray is €111. These costs include accommodation (assuming double occupancy, so the traveler is sharing the room), food, transportation, and entertainment. While every person is different, these costs are an average of past travelers in each destination. What follows is a categorical breakdown of travel costs for Lagos and Ezcaray in more detail.
